⚠️ Claim
Reid Wiseman, commander of NASA’s Artemis II mission, said he converted to Christianity after his trip to the moon.
❌ Rating: FALSE
📋 Context
Reid Wiseman did not publicly announce that he converted to Christianity after the Artemis II mission. Social media posts exaggerated his remarks about an emotional moment with a Navy chaplain after splashdown. Wiseman said he was “not really a religious person” and described breaking down in tears after seeing the cross on the chaplain’s collar — but that is not the same as publicly saying he became a Christian.
🔍 What Actually Happened
In April 2026, social media users spread claims that Artemis II commander Reid Wiseman had converted to Christianity after returning from the NASA moon mission. The posts cited emotional remarks he made about seeing a cross on a Navy chaplain’s collar following splashdown.
One viral Instagram post read:
🚨 BREAKING: Atheist Artemis II astronaut Reid Wiseman says he has CONVERTED to Christianity after his trip to moon:
“There is no other explanation for what I saw and experienced. When we landed back on earth, I saw the cross and just wept.”
However, fact-checkers at Snopes found no evidence that Wiseman ever made such a public declaration of faith or described himself as having converted to Christianity. His emotional reaction after returning from a historic lunar mission was taken out of context and amplified across social media platforms.

✅ Bottom Line
Wiseman’s tearful reaction upon seeing a chaplain’s cross after splashdown was a deeply personal emotional moment — not a public conversion announcement.
